A man paid RM150 for his monthly parking on a private island, only to lose Rm2,000.

The car owner posted about the incident on social media and said two of his tyres were stolen before lodging a report. In an official statement, PDRM in Manjung, Perak, said they are currently on the hunt for the perpetrator.

Screenshot 2024 11 24 170410

PDRM also said that the car owner was on Pangkor Island at the time of the incident and only found out that his tyres had been stolen when he was notified by a friend.

“The tyres and rims were estimated to be worth about RM2,000.”

The car had been parked on the premises in Pangkor Island since November 14 before the theft, and the police are currently investigating the case under Section 379 of the Penal Code (theft).
